Most recently a survey conducted by KPMG on Ransomware campaigns in 2020 reported over 2.5 million ransomware attacks from across 200 countries in total. Following this, by 2022 approximately 40% of internet users globally admitted to experiencing cybercrime in different aspects. 


The UAE has not been immune to such types of threats in the past. Moreover, a UK-based technology comparison portal revealed that victims in the UAE lose money to cybercrime. It stated that over US$746 million to cybercrime on an annual basis in the country. Additionally, they predict the numbers to increase in the future.

The UAE government has been active in addressing the issue. They have introduced Federal Decree-law on Personal Data Protection Law which is considered to be a significant step in this direction. Learn More here Data Protection and Breach Lawyers in Dubai.


This law is designed to mandate corporations and businesses in the UAE. They are encouraged to adopt systems and processes. Rather the effort is aimed at ensuring the protection of users' rights across the region.


 Alongside, it also ensures compliance with local laws and regulations. It also ensures compliance with international data protection regulations including the European Union General Data Protection Regulation.


One of the most critical aspects of this regulation is the need for creating consent forms and disclaimers. It is done for personal data processing. 


Nonetheless, by doing so obtaining consent is made explicit. Therefore, users give consent before collecting, processing, or sharing their data. This provides a greater level of security to the personal data.


Additionally, businesses and enterprises need to establish effective data protection assessments. This is done to identify potential risks that may trigger. Besides, it also highlights the threats and vulnerabilities related to data handling processes.


Furthermore, appointing a data protection officer is another crucial step in this regard. This is an effective way to demonstrate a company's commitment and dedication towards personal data protection. 


Besides, it ensures there is a professional and well-trained person or team appointed to serve the purpose. The team is responsible for overseeing data protection measures on a day-to-day basis. This will ensure continuous security. 


More accuracy of documentation in the processes and systems is also associated with personal data processing. It is essential for monitoring and auditing data protection. It is a way to safeguard the processes regularly that ensures compliance with the law.


Robust internal and external breaches are important. In addition, the grievance redressal mechanisms are also equally essential. It will assist in detecting and responding to data breaches. They efficiently provide potential users with the right direction to file complaints in case of any kind of violation.
